1樓:匿名使用者
你建乙個父類,在父類類檔案中建乙個方法來判斷是否有session值,沒有的話就讓他跳到登入頁面,有的話就不做反應
其他的類需要驗證session的話,就繼承該父類~
<?php
class baseaction extends action
} public function checksession()else}}
?>
建乙個子類繼承改父類
<?php
class useraction extends baseaction
?>
這樣,每次使用子類的時候就會自動去驗證session 不用每次都判斷session
2樓:不跳主城
可以考慮用cookie代替
thinkphp 分配到模板頁面,if標籤可以判斷session嗎
3樓:匿名使用者
判斷肯定是可以,關鍵是用於什麼用途,因為$_session內基本都已賦值。
4樓:癲狂蚊子
可以 只要在condition裡面加入就可以了
thinkphp session儲存或讀取不了!! 5
5樓:匿名使用者
直接用s()方法就可以快取了啊
刪除快取其實就是把runtime的資料夾給清空了
6樓:匿名使用者
tp session 取值方法抄是不需要 session_start(); 的
$value = session('name');
不懂的可以直接檢視手冊
7樓:胡勝賴
設定php.ini中的session.use_trans_sid = 1
8樓:匿名使用者
清除linux /tmp下的session_***xx
9樓:匿名使用者
哥們 你這個問題是怎麼解決的,我現在出現和你一樣的情況!~拜託了
thinkphp if標籤裡面可以判斷session嗎
10樓:匿名使用者
*****=已經登入了*****=
-----------未登入----------
實測是可以的。
thinkphp 資訊記錄到session 怎麼在讀取出來
11樓:匿名使用者
echo session('name');
thinkphp框架的session快取目錄在那裡?急需!!! 30
12樓:匿名使用者
這個路徑是可以在配置檔案裡設定的
13樓:**愛傻妞
print_r(session_save_path());
//d:\phpstudy\tmp\tmp
thinkphpk中判斷session
14樓:匿名使用者
方法很來多,靈活運用,例自
如1.在模板中呼叫
2.在標籤直接編寫php**來判斷$_session3.在模板中寫<?php ?>,然後在裡面直接編寫php**來判斷$_session
4.在action中將$_session變數通過assign()方法賦值給模板
5.在自定義函式庫中,新建乙個函式用來返回$_session變數,然後在模板檔案中使用來將函式返回的$_session賦給模板中的乙個變數
以上五種方法皆可,你也可以想自己的辦法。
thinkphp中 session是預設開啟的嗎
15樓:匿名使用者
thinkphp3.0完全開發手冊 19.1 session:
bai支援預設情況下,初du始化zhi之後系統dao會自動版啟動session。
如果不希望系統自動啟動session的話,可以設定session_auto_start為
權false,例如:
'session_auto_start' =>false
php中 用的是thinkphp模板 怎麼樣讓使用者保持在登入狀態用session
16樓:匿名使用者
thinkphp中是通過在專案資料夾下的conf資料夾下面的config.php重新對session進行「增,刪,改,查」配置的
版,首先找到相權對的部分然後看使用哪種方法進行cookie的,假如是mencache伺服器上儲存的那還有mencache的配置方法,實現的方式很多,具體的要看過才知道哦
17樓:匿名使用者
用session記錄最後一次操作copy
,如果使用者有操作則修改一下時間。在thinkphp中,你可以寫乙個baseaction,讓你所有的action繼承它,在它裡面寫乙個方法用於記錄你最後一次操作的時間,超過了那個時間久跳轉到登入頁面。
18樓:天子古躍
不知道專案是怎麼寫的,如果在_initialize裡做的登陸驗證,那就在這裡重新定義一下session時間,因為每個方法呼叫之前都會用到這個驗證,即操作就驗證。
ubuntu裡apache配置檔案httpdconf在哪個資料夾
你是否是用apt 安裝的?那就是在 etc apache 下面 ubuntu下找不到apache的配置檔案httpd.conf,求助 5 這裡有apache的預設檔案布局,可以看到,ubuntu和debian下沒有http.conf,取而代之的是 etc apache2 apache2.conf 網...
lotusnotes853配置檔案在什麼地方
lotus notes lotus domino 配置檔案都叫 notes.ini 在安裝目錄中,你搜尋下。win7 lotus notes 客戶端id應該放在哪個目錄下 id檔案是由伺服器端生成的,需要管理員根椐使用者資訊在lotus administrator裡進行使用者id註冊,可以在lotu...
如何檢視apache的httpd配置檔案
你可以是用httpd v命令檢視,其中httpd root和server config file 就可以確定httpd.conf的路徑了 linux下如何找到apache的安裝目錄。找到apache的配置檔案?apache的配置檔案可以通過下述指令進行查詢 find name apache 1 採用...